What to Look for When Buying Replacement Windows

July 22, 2021

Purchasing replacement windows as an installer is an entirely different process to what it would be for the end customer. The questions to ask are not the same, nor are the concerns that might arise. If you own a replacement window business, or you are about to enter the industry, this article is ideal for you.

Best-in-Class Supplier

When it comes to UPVC suppliers, the first thing you should look at is how long they’ve been in business. Quality lasts over the years, and so it is the case for suppliers too. The supplier must have longevity on their side. This way, should there ever be any comeback on their window frames, someone will pick up on the other end of the line. While you hope that never happens, plan for the worst while hoping for the best. When choosing a UPVC supplier, go for a reputable name like Veka. Veka was issued an A rating (BFRC) for a PVCU window design in the UK. And they were the first in the country. That says a lot. 

Reliability of the Materials

The materials used and how they’re crafted need to stand up to all types of weather, especially when they face out to the exterior. Regardless of whether it’s a casement window or a reversible or flush sash design, obtaining quality trade products to install on behalf of your customers is important. Otherwise, you’ll only get headaches later. Paying up for better-quality materials proves worthwhile because the cost to rectify a problem at a later date is unpleasant when using an inferior window supplier. 

UPVC Specialist, not a Generalist

There are trade suppliers that cover all types of windows. They may offer aluminium, PVC, wood, and more. The difficulty you potentially get with a generalist supplier is that they’re less knowledgeable. Generalists are a master of none which, when they’re your main supplier of UPVC windows, shouldn’t be what you want to hear.

Do They Have a Good Reputation in the Industry?

If the UPVC supplier has been around for a good length of time, they’ll have many past and present trade customers. Also, people will have strong opinions about them. Search for reviews online to see what people in the trade are saying. Also, look at end customer reviews too. Bear in mind that customers may have received a quality frame but a bad installer, so consider that when reading their comments. 

Also, talk with people you know in the industry. Get their take on the supplier to see what they think. Have they used them recently? What was their experience? Some may have negative things to say but have not dealt with them in many years. Get the lowdown from your peers to see what they think too.

Purchasing UPVC window replacements from a supplier needs to be done with care. This way, smart decisions are made that you won’t regret later.
